According to 6Wresearch internal database and industry insights, the Global Reciprocating Pumps Market was valued at USD 9.6 Billion in 2024 and is expected to reach USD 13.5 Billion by 2031, growing at a compound annual growth rate of 5.20% during the forecast period (2025-2031).
The Global Reciprocating Pumps Market is witnessing steady growth driven by increasing demand in various industries such as oil & gas, water & wastewater treatment, and chemical processing. Reciprocating pumps are preferred for their ability to handle high-pressure applications and deliver precise flow rates, making them essential in processes requiring accurate dosing and pumping. The market is also benefiting from technological advancements, such as the development of smart pumps with IoT capabilities for remote monitoring and control. Key players in the market are focusing on product innovation and strategic partnerships to expand their market presence. However, challenges such as high maintenance costs and competition from alternative pump technologies like centrifugal pumps may hinder market growth in the coming years.

The Global Reciprocating Pumps Market faces several challenges, including intense competition from other pump technologies such as centrifugal pumps, which offer higher efficiency and lower maintenance requirements. Additionally, fluctuating raw material prices impact the manufacturing costs of reciprocating pumps, affecting profit margins for manufacturers. Market saturation in certain regions also poses a challenge, leading to price wars and reduced profitability. Moreover, stringent regulations regarding energy efficiency and emissions control drive the need for continuous innovation and investment in research and development to meet sustainability requirements. Lastly, the COVID-19 pandemic has disrupted global supply chains and manufacturing operations, leading to delays in production and distribution, further impacting the market growth of reciprocating pumps.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
